NX Open C++ Reference Guide
|
CAE Edge/Curve Geometric Properties. More...
Public Member Functions | |
CaeCurve (double arcLengthParameterInitial, double unitArcLengthParameterInitial, const NXOpen::Point3d &closestPointInWcsInitial, const NXOpen::Vector3d &normalInWcsInitial, const NXOpen::Vector3d &tangentInWcsInitial, const NXOpen::Vector3d &tangentInitial, const NXOpen::Vector3d &normalInitial, const NXOpen::Point3d &closestPointInitial) | |
Constructor for the CaeCurve struct. | |
Public Attributes | |
double | ArcLengthParameter |
ArcLength parametrization. | |
NXOpen::Point3d | ClosestPoint |
closest point on curve in Root Part Coordinates | |
NXOpen::Point3d | ClosestPointInWcs |
closest point on curve in Work Part Coordinates | |
NXOpen::Vector3d | Normal |
normal of closest point in Root Part Coordinates | |
NXOpen::Vector3d | NormalInWcs |
normal of closest point in Work Part Coordinates | |
NXOpen::Vector3d | Tangent |
tangent of closest point in Root Part Coordinates | |
NXOpen::Vector3d | TangentInWcs |
tangent of closest point in Work Part Coordinates | |
double | UnitArcLengthParameter |
UnitArcLength parametrization. | |
CAE Edge/Curve Geometric Properties.
N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::CaeCurve | ( | double | arcLengthParameterInitial, |
double | unitArcLengthParameterInitial, | ||
const NXOpen::Point3d & | closestPointInWcsInitial, | ||
const NXOpen::Vector3d & | normalInWcsInitial, | ||
const NXOpen::Vector3d & | tangentInWcsInitial, | ||
const NXOpen::Vector3d & | tangentInitial, | ||
const NXOpen::Vector3d & | normalInitial, | ||
const NXOpen::Point3d & | closestPointInitial | ||
) |
Constructor for the CaeCurve struct.
arcLengthParameterInitial | ArcLength parametrization |
unitArcLengthParameterInitial | UnitArcLength parametrization |
closestPointInWcsInitial | closest point on curve in Work Part Coordinates |
normalInWcsInitial | normal of closest point in Work Part Coordinates |
tangentInWcsInitial | tangent of closest point in Work Part Coordinates |
tangentInitial | tangent of closest point in Root Part Coordinates |
normalInitial | normal of closest point in Root Part Coordinates |
closestPointInitial | closest point on curve in Root Part Coordinates |
double N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::ArcLengthParameter |
ArcLength parametrization.
NXOpen::Point3d N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::ClosestPoint |
closest point on curve in Root Part Coordinates
NXOpen::Point3d N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::ClosestPointInWcs |
closest point on curve in Work Part Coordinates
NXOpen::Vector3d N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::Normal |
normal of closest point in Root Part Coordinates
NXOpen::Vector3d N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::NormalInWcs |
normal of closest point in Work Part Coordinates
NXOpen::Vector3d N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::Tangent |
tangent of closest point in Root Part Coordinates
NXOpen::Vector3d N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::TangentInWcs |
tangent of closest point in Work Part Coordinates
double NXOpen::GeometricAnalysis::GeometricProperties::CaeCurve::UnitArcLengthParameter |
UnitArcLength parametrization.